About the Item
\" These bells would have been used on farm animals collars,differant size and style bells for each animal. Very decorative, these are great in groups of varying sizes.\" Kelly

Walter Bosse Cow Candleholder, Hertha Baller, Blackened Brass, 1960
By Walter Bosse, Herta Baller
Located in Hausmannstätten, AT
A candleholder in the form of a cow by Walter Bosse and manufactured by Hertha Baller, Austria, Vienna, in midcentury, circa 1960 (late 1950s or early 1960s).
The candleholder is made of blackened and polished brass. It can be used for small ball shaped candles.
